Analysis and evaluation of a user's message are likely to occur during which type of listening?

a. Discriminative
b. Comprehensive
c. Critical
d. Relational

Final answer:

Analysis and evaluation of a user's message are likely to occur during critical listening.

Step-by-step explanation:

Analysis and evaluation of a user's message are likely to occur during the critical type of listening. Critical listening involves actively evaluating and analyzing the content, tone, and intentions of a message. It goes beyond just understanding the information and requires assessing the message critically.

Critical listening is a type of listening where the listener evaluates the message's content, logic, and evidence. In this context, listeners are engaged in examining information, assessing its validity, and making judgments about its value.
